Understanding Partnerships in California

Partnerships are business arrangements that define ownership, management, and liability among partners.

We explain how LPs, LLPs, and GPs differ, including formation steps, fiduciary duties, and ongoing compliance.

Definition and Explanation

A partnership is an arrangement where two or more parties share profits, losses, and management responsibilities, which can be structured as LPs, LLPs, or GPs.

Key Elements and Processes

Elements include formation documents or partnership agreements, capital contributions, ownership shares, governance rules, and steps to form or convert a business entity in California.

Key Terms and Glossary

Glossary definitions for common terms used in partnership setup and administration.

Partnership Agreement

A contract among partners outlining roles, contributions, profit sharing, and dispute resolution.

Limited Partnership (LP)

A structure with at least one general partner who manages the business and one or more limited partners who contribute capital with limited liability.

General Partner (GP)

An individual or entity responsible for day-to-day management and fiduciary duties within a partnership.

Operating Agreement

A governing document for LLCs that outlines ownership, management, and distribution rules.

What is a partnership agreement and why is it important?

A partnership agreement is a written contract among partners that outlines ownership interests, capital contributions, profit sharing, and the process for resolving disputes. It sets the foundation for governance and accountability.

Liability in an LP is typically shared between general partners who manage the business and may be limited for passive investors. In an LLP, liability protections apply to partners, while management duties are shared according to the agreement.
